For Brody Grant, his bug for performing all started with his love for Star Wars. He shares insights into his journey from being a shy kid and relating to the original "The Outsiders" book to receiving a Tony nomination for his role as Ponyboy (it’s just destiny!). He reflects on the significance of the book and how it resonated with both him and his mom, one of the most important people in his life. Brody discusses his initial audition experience, feeling uncertain about pursuing acting amidst his focus on music and songwriting. His passion for acting and love for "The Outsiders" persisted, eventually leading to his casting as Soda Pop and later as Ponyboy. Brody highlights the supportive and collaborative environment fostered by their director, Danya Taymor, emphasizing the importance of chosen family and genuine connections among the cast members. He shares moments of vulnerability and bonding during rehearsals, where checking in with one another became a norm, fostering a sense of trust and camaraderie. Nominated for the Tony Award for Best Performance by an Actor in a Leading Role in a Musical, he recalls how he found out about it through his mom, and the overwhelming support he got from his family and friends–proving that “if you continue to water the seed of the garden that you're in, you're going to end up with a forest and it's going to be beautiful.” Brody Grant is a New York-based, multi-hyphenate independent recording artist who has appeared in productions like “Parade” at the New York City Center and “The Outsiders” at La Jolla Playhouse. He just made his Broadway debut in “The Outsiders” as Ponyboy Michael Curtis, which has already nabbed him a Tony Award nomination for Best Performance by an Actor in a Leading Role in a Musical.
